What is Turnitin AI Detection?

Table of Contents

Direct Answer - Turnitin AI detection is an academic integrity feature integrated into Turnitin's Similarity Report that identifies text segments in submitted documents that may have been generated by artificial intelligence tools such as ChatGPT, Claude, or Gemini [1]. The system analyzes sentence-level writing patterns across overlapping prose segments and assigns a score to predict whether the text was written by a human or an AI. The result appears as an AI writing indicator showing an overall percentage, with color-coded highlights that allow educators to review flagged passages at the sentence level [1]. Turnitin emphasizes that this indicator is designed to inform educator judgment, not to serve as a definitive determination of misconduct.

How Does Turnitin AI Detection Work?

Turnitin AI detection operates by breaking a submitted document into segments of roughly a few hundred words—typically five to ten sentences—and overlapping these segments to ensure each sentence is evaluated in context [1]. Each segment is then run through a detection model trained exclusively on academic writing datasets, which scores the text on a scale from 0 to 1 [2]. Segments scoring closer to 1 are predicted as AI-generated, while those closer to 0 are classified as human-written.

The detection model analyzes patterns such as sentence structure consistency, word predictability, and stylistic uniformity that distinguish machine-generated prose from human writing [2]. It is important to note that the model only evaluates prose text; bullet points, mathematical equations, code snippets, and list items are excluded from the AI detection analysis [1]. After scoring, the AI writing report displays a color-coded highlight overlay on the document—blue for text predicted as AI-generated and teal for human-predicted text—enabling educators to review flagged passages at a granular level [2].

Because the model was trained on a curated corpus of both human-authored academic essays and AI-generated outputs from multiple large language models, it can detect content produced by a wide range of AI tools, including GPT-4, Claude, Gemini, and others [1]. The system is continuously updated as new language models emerge, ensuring that its detection capabilities remain effective against evolving AI writing technology [1].

What Percentage Does Turnitin Flag As AI?

The AI writing detection indicator displays an overall percentage between 0% and 100%, representing the proportion of the document that the model predicts may have been generated by an AI tool [3]. However, Turnitin applies a specific threshold for low-confidence scores: any percentage below 20% is displayed as an asterisk (∗%) rather than as a specific low number such as 3% or 12% [3]. This design choice prevents instructors from over-interpreting small signals that fall below the model's confidence threshold.

For scores at or above 20%, the indicator uses a color-coded system to visually communicate the level of concern. Scores between 20% and 80% appear in yellow or orange, signaling a moderate likelihood of AI generation. Scores above 80% appear in red, indicating a high probability that the flagged content was AI-produced [3]. Turnitin reports a false positive rate of less than 1% for its AI writing detection indicator, meaning that fewer than 1 in 100 documents written entirely by a human are incorrectly flagged as containing AI-generated text [1].

Importantly, the percentage shown in the AI indicator does not always match the exact proportion of highlighted text in the document. This discrepancy can occur when non-prose content (such as references, headings, or equations) is excluded from the detection analysis but still counted in the overall document length [1]. Educators are advised to use the AI indicator as one data point among others rather than as a standalone basis for academic integrity decisions [3].

Can You Check Your Document For Turnitin AI Detection Before Submitting?

Under standard Turnitin configurations, students cannot independently run an AI detection report on their work before submitting it to an instructor-created assignment [4]. The AI writing indicator is visible only to instructors and administrators through their institutional Turnitin accounts, not to students who upload their papers [1]. This means that students typically see their AI detection score for the first time only after their instructor reviews the report.

There are limited exceptions. If a student's institution has enabled Turnitin Draft Coach, students can run similarity and citation checks directly within Google Docs or Microsoft Word before final submission [4]. However, Draft Coach's AI detection availability depends on institutional licensing. Alternatively, instructors may set up assignments that allow resubmissions, enabling students to upload drafts and receive reports before the final deadline—though resubmission policies vary by assignment type [4].

Q: Does Turnitin detect AI writing from all language models?
Turnitin's AI detection model is trained to identify text generated by major large language models (LLMs), including GPT-4, ChatGPT, Claude, Gemini, and others [1]. The model is regularly updated as new AI writing tools emerge to maintain detection effectiveness [1].

Q: Can Turnitin detect AI-paraphrased content?
Yes. Turnitin has added AI paraphrasing detection capabilities that identify text rewritten using AI paraphrasing tools, in addition to its standard AI writing detection [1]. This feature operates alongside the existing AI indicator.

Q: Will Grammarly flag my document as AI-generated?
Standard grammar-check features in Grammarly are generally not flagged as AI writing by Turnitin [1]. However, Grammarly's full AI text generation or AI paraphrasing tools may be detected depending on how extensively they are used.

Q: What should I do if my document is flagged incorrectly?
Turnitin maintains a false positive rate below 1% for its AI detection indicator, meaning incorrect flags are rare [1]. If you believe a flag is inaccurate, consult your instructor, who can review the highlighted passages in context and consider other evidence before making any academic integrity determination.

Q: Is Turnitin AI detection available for non-English submissions?
Turnitin's AI writing detection is currently optimized for English-language submissions, with separate detection models available for Spanish and Japanese [1]. Submissions in other languages may not be accurately evaluated by the AI detection system.
